There is no known issue relating to Windows 11 specifically, but if the game has issues with launching, it may be a graphics issue.
You can try switching the renderer the game uses. For this, you hold the shift key during start-up or shift+G once the game has launched, if it can launch at all. Then try the different renderers from the menu.
If this doesn't work, you could try running it as an administrator, running it in compatibility mode or checking if the game is being blocked by your antivirus programme. If none of this works, you can try reinstalling your graphics driver as it could be caused by a faulty driver installation.